Setsuo Nara (奈良 節雄, Nara Setsuo, 16 December 1936 – 27 January 2000[1][2]) was a Japanese basketball player. He competed in the men's tournament at the 1956 Summer Olympics, the 1960 Summer Olympics, and the 1964 Summer Olympics.[3]
